A Master Artisanal Weaver in the Making

Imagine discovering a skilled artisan in the most unlikely of places—a verdant corner of the tropical forests of Brazil and Peru. This is where you find Alpaida tuonabo, a member of the spider family Araneidae, spinning its intricate web. First identified by the arachnologist Cândido Firmino de Mello-Leitão in the mid-20th century, these spiders are fascinating creatures that remind us of the hidden wonders of the natural world.

The Fascinating World of Alpaida tuonabo

So, what is it about Alpaida tuonabo that captivates the minds of scientists and nature enthusiasts alike? As an orb-weaving spider, it's all about their skill in creating precise and symmetric webs. These webs not only demonstrate beauty in the natural world but also highlight the incredible evolutionary adaptations that allow the species to thrive.

Primarily nocturnal, Alpaida tuonabo builds its circular web under the cover of darkness, repairing or even reconstructing it each night if necessary. Members of this species have specialized silk glands producing different kinds of silk for specific purposes. The sticky silk is used in the capture spiral to catch prey, while non-sticky silk forms the web’s infrastructure, showcasing a sophisticated, multi-purpose architectural design.

The Ecosystem Role: More Than Just a Predator

In these rain-soaked jungles, Alpaida tuonabo plays a significant role as both predator and prey within its ecosystem. It primarily feeds on small flying insects, using its web to ensnare these unsuspecting creatures. In doing so, it helps to control insect populations, naturally balancing the ecosystem.

However, the story doesn't end there. Alpaida tuonabo itself serves as a crucial food source for larger animals, including birds and other arachnids, making it an integral part of the food web. Adaptations That Keep Alpaida tuonabo at the Top of Its Game

One might wonder: what allows Alpaida tuonabo to survive and thrive in such a competitive environment? It all comes down to its remarkable adaptation strategies. For starters, the color patterns of Alpaida tuonabo help it blend seamlessly with its surroundings, a perfect camouflage to avoid detection by both predators and prey.

Adding to its survival toolkit is the ability to quickly reconstitute its web if damaged. This adaptability speaks volumes about the resilience of Alpaida tuonabo in the face of environmental challenges, demonstrating why evolutionary biology is as fascinating as it is enlightening.
